SelVid - Conservation and Selection of Ancient Grapevine VarietiesProject reference | PDR2020-7.8.4-FEADER-042704 Main objective | To perform the conservation and breeding of several important grapevine varieties. It includes: (1) morphological, agronomical, biochemical and biomolecular characterization of clones from 13 ancient varieties; (2) Agronomical and technological evaluation of clones from other 16 varieties; (3) registration in the National Catalog of Varieties of 63 clones (7 clones of each of 9 varieties: Avesso, Azal Branco, Borraçal, Moscatel Galego, Moscatel Graúdo, Rabigato, Touriga Nacional, Viosinho, Vital). SuberPhyto - Unconventional approaches in our struggle against Phytophthora in the cork oak forest. Zooming-in on the microbiomeProject reference | PTDC/ASP-SIL/29776/2017 Main objective | Phytophthora spp. cause devastating effects around the world, with special emphasis on the Portuguese ‘montado’, since neither cure nor control can be achieved. Quercus suber is only moderately susceptible to Phytophthora, thus supporting field observations that other causes sensitize the plants to infection. This proposal will (i) select plant consociations for the herbaceous layer which make soil conditions unfavorable to Phytophthora, (ii) identify environmental constraints expected to sensitize plants to infection, and (iii) test potent biostimulants/defense boosters.
